Nimbus Manticore Uses NightLedger and WebSocket Tunnels to Build Covert Relays

On July 28, 2026, Kaspersky detailed a campaign by the Iranian state-backed group Nimbus Manticore, also tracked as UNC1549, involving the previously undocumented Windows backdoor NightLedger and two custom WebSocket tunnelers, BridgeHead and ArcBridge.

Why covert relays increase the risk

Targets span Egypt; SMB and government environments in Jordan and Tanzania; aviation organizations in Pakistan; telecom companies in Ethiopia; and financial entities in Burkina Faso. The initial access method remains unknown, although the group has previously used tailored job-themed phishing, brand impersonation, and lookalike videoconferencing pages.

The tunnelers turn infected systems into operator-controlled gateways. Traffic can appear to originate within the victim’s network, making malicious activity harder to trace and giving server-side tools a route towards internal targets.

How the toolset operates

NightLedger is launched through DLL side-loading and communicates with an external server over HTTPS. It supports reconnaissance, process and drive enumeration, command execution, file transfer, DLL loading, screenshots, beacon updates, and collection of C:\Windows\debug\NetSetup.log. Its command handling resembles the earlier TWOSTROKE backdoor.

“The C2 server initiates all tunnel connections by sending binary commands over the WebSocket; the implant simply forwards traffic between server-specified targets and the WebSocket channel,” Kaspersky researchers Omar Amin and Vasily Berdnikov said of BridgeHead.

BridgeHead, observed as “unbcl.dll” in Egypt and Pakistan, is a SOCKS5 tunnel proxy with functional overlaps with MiniFast. ArcBridge appeared in April 2026 activity targeting Middle Eastern victims. The group previously deployed bespoke tunnelers LIGHTRAIL and POLLBLEND.

Separately, Group-IB linked HOLLOWGRAPH to Cavern Manticore. The malware uses Microsoft Graph API and a compromised Microsoft 365 calendar as a two-way C2 channel, placing tasks and encrypted stolen files in events dated May 13, 2050.

Businesses should monitor unusual DLL loading, outbound HTTPS and WebSocket sessions, SOCKS-like relay behavior, and anomalous Microsoft 365 calendar activity. A compromised endpoint may become trusted infrastructure for deeper intrusion, not merely a source of data loss.
